Mar_1:32 f.
Ὀψίας
…
ἥλιος
] an exact specification of time (comp. Matthew and Luke) for the purpose of indicating that the close of the Sabbath had occurred. “Judaeos religio tenebat, quominus ante exitum sabbati aegrotos suos afferrent,” Wetstein, and, earlier, Victor Antiochenus.
πρὸς
αὐτόν
] presupposes that before the evening He has returned again to His own dwelling (Mar_2:1; Mar_2:15). It is not Peter’s house that is meant.
πάντας
τοὺς
κ
.
τ
.
λ
.] all whom they had.
Here and at Mar_1:34, as also at Mat_8:16, the naturally sick are distinguished from the demoniacs; comp. Mar_3:15.
